3 Microenterprise Access to Banking Services (MABS) Program The program assists banks to develop the capability to profitably provide financial services to microenterprises through technical assistance and training.
4 Rural Banks in the Philippines Wide network coverage: 760 rural banks; over 2,000 branches Over 50 year history US$2 billion in assets Over 5 million deposit accounts Over 1 million borrowers
5 MABS Partner Rural Banks As of June 2007 MABS works with 90 rural banks through 337 branches Over 165,000 active microenterprise borrowers Over 390,000 new micro borrowers served since 1998 Over 410,000 new micro deposit accounts
6 Challenges Reaching deeper into rural areas without costly investments in infrastructure Reducing costs of servicing Avoiding security risks from robbery, holdup Reducing costs to clients
7 Challenges for Rural Banks to reach Rural Clients High Transaction Costs Transportation Cost Loss of business opportunity Security risk

13 Globe Telecom Leading mobile phone operator in the Philippines Increasing focus on the bottom of the pyramid ; willing and able to partner with MABS and rural banks Handles over 250 million messages/day Developed G-Cash platform in 2004 More than 500,000 active users More than 500 G-Cash partners More than 4,900 outlets Transactions in 2006 exceeded $700M
14 What is G-CASH? G-Cash is the service of Globe telcom that turns a mobile phone into an electronic wallet. It is a reliable, accessible and easy way to: Buy & sell goods and services Send / Receive remittances locally or from abroad Pay bills and taxes; school tuition fees Load cell phone airtime credit Transfer money from one person s phone to another
15 Key Features Reliable recognized by BSP as a new payment system Secure - uses PIN Safe - all transactions are recorded in an electronic ledger in Globe Convenient - all you need is your cell phone Fast - moves at the speed of text messaging Easy to Use - as easy as sending a text message Meets AML (Anti-Money Laundering Law) requirements - requires all users to register via text with their personal details

25 Case of Cantilan Bank Profile Motivation Mobile Banking Solution Issue Remedy Actual Benefits 10-branch Rural Bank Reduce cost and increase efficiency of loan collections Text-A-Payment Lack of Cash-In locations Create G-Cash resellers via Text-A-Withdrawal service For Bank Time Saving; cost of collection reduced
26 Case of Bangko Kabayan Profile Motivation Mobile Banking Solution 9-branch Rural Bank Expand outreach to rural areas Text-A-Payment Issue Remedy Actual Benefits Lack of Cash-In locations Create G-Cash resellers via Text-A-Withdrawal service Expand outreach; Reduced transaction costs; convenient for clients
27 Case of 1 st Valley Bank Profile Motivation Mobile Banking Solution 16-branch Rural Bank Increase deposit base and offer bill collection services -Partnered with an electric cooperative -Offering customers Text-A-BillPay service -M-Payment services for local merchants Actual Benefits Able to remotely accept bills payment; Increase Deposit Balance; Merchants become new bank depositors

30 Main Challenges Lack of Re-sellers (Cash-in outlets) Introduced TEXT-A-SWELDO (salary) service Banks pay employee salaries and bonuses with G- Cash. Created a critical mass of people carrying G-Cash in their mobile phones, using the technology, and familiar with different services and benefits Employees help with promotions.
31 Main Challenges Still, rural re-sellers are lacking Text-A-Withdrawal (TAW) service developed so bank depositors can withdraw savings remotely, and be G-Cash re-sellers. Unique business benefits to re-seller 1% fee earned is more than the interest rate on bank deposit; nofee transaction with bank; no hassle withdrawal in seconds
32 Main Challenges Marketing to convince more people to embrace the technology and use the services. Eco-system rollout: MABS work with rural banks to train and accredit merchants and shops to accept G-Cash in payment for goods and services. Telecom co-branding with partner rural banks for marketing materials Telecom support for merchandizing materials, like tarpaulins and standees promoting G-Cash services.
33 Main Challenges Training and reaching more users, overcoming initial fear of USE technology and SECURITY of their money. Whether it is the bank, the merchant, the end user, presenting the unique benefits helped. Globe offered 10% discount on pre-paid airtime load using G-cash; opportunity to earn; frequency of use establishes G-Cash security, ease and convenience.
